当前位置:得优网 →文章资讯 → 求职指南 → 求职笔试面试 → 笔试题目→笔试题(进程)
华为最后三个大题 1.A,B,C,D四个进程,A向buf里面写数据,B,C,D向buf里面读数据,当A写完,且B,C,D都读一次后,A才能再写。用P,V操作实现。 2.将单向链表reverse,如ABCD变成DCBA,只能搜索链表一次。 3.将二叉树的两个孩子换位置,即左变右,右变左。不能用递规(变态!)
华为D卷最后四大题 1、A1,A2….An和B交换资源,求写出PV操作的序列 2、非递归实现废物不拉屎数列. 3、折半查找干啥用的? 实现之. 4、实现有序链表上的插入
相关分类